Explosive Detection and Identification in Railway Infrastructure

Railway infrastructure presents a unique challenge for security personnel due to the vast expanse of track, rolling stock, and associated facilities. The possibility of concealed munitions or ordnance posing a significant threat necessitates comprehensive search protocols.

Effective ordnance analysis relies on a multi-faceted approach that combines advanced technologies with trained personnel. Sensors capable of identifying minute traces of chemical signatures can be deployed along tracks and within stations. K9 teams trained to detect specific scents associated with munitions also play a crucial role in assessing potential threats.

Furthermore, regular inspections of railway infrastructure components, such as signals, are essential for identifying any anomalies or suspicious activity.

Cooperation between railway operators, law enforcement agencies, and intelligence experts is paramount in ensuring a robust countermeasure to potential threats. Through the implementation of these comprehensive measures, railway infrastructure can be effectively secured against the risk posed by ordnance.

Explosive Remnants of War (ERW) Investigation for Rail Tracts

Rail tracts represent a vital backbone for transportation. However, these tracks can also be susceptible to the dangers of explosive remnants of war (ERW). ERW investigation for rail tracts is a crucial process to locate and remove these severely dangerous devices. This involves detailed surveys utilizing specialized technology to identify the presence of ERW along rail lines.

Consequently, safe and reliable railway operations can be maintained. The methodology also contributes in protecting human life and assets.

  • Scheduled ERW investigations are essential for guaranteeing the safety of rail operations.
  • Specialized teams execute these investigations using advanced technology.
  • Partnership between rail authorities, national agencies, and international organizations is crucial for effective ERW control.
